Biographical history
James McHale was born in Ireland circa 1837. He married Catherine McKernan (1839-?) in 1859 and they had at least five children. James (1864-?) and William J. (1866-?) were born in New Brunswick, Wallace Frances (1869-?) and Joseph A. (1872-?) were born in New Jersey, in the United States. James had moved to Prince Edward Island by 1873, as he was licensed as a general merchant for a country store in Summerside that year. The following year James and Catherine's fifth child, Charles Edward was born. In 1884, James and his family moved to Colorado, USA.

Scope and content
The fonds consists of a daybook of James McHale, with entries dating from 1877 to1916. Included in the enteries from 1877 to 1884 are accounts for the patrons of his general store in Summerside. The entries after 1884 list the work McHale completed for various individuals as well as his expenditures.
